Severity: High. The Duskmere retention sweeper is interpreting the `expires_at` boundary as exclusive of the grace window, so records entering their final 24-hour hold are purged a full cycle early. Confirmed on the Oakenshaw replica: 312 rows removed ahead of policy. Backups cover everything affected so far. On-call should pause the sweeper cron, restore from the nightly snapshot, and hold deploys until the boundary fix lands. The offending release is identified by the marker below.

session token of tajef-bageg = htk21_5d90d574934f3ccae6437

## Runbook: Polyglotta string extraction

If the nightly extraction job for Polyglotta wedges, don't just rerun it — it locks the catalog directory and a second run will deadlock. Kill the stale lockfile first, then relaunch with the standard flags. The script is forgiving about partial catalogs but not about encoding overrides, so leave those alone. It expects the configuration shown below to be present at startup.

service settings:
PRAIX_LOG_LEVEL=error
PRAIX_METRICS_HOST=metrics.praix.qorvelcorp.corp
PRAIX_POOL_SIZE=16

The Ledgerline payments service has shown intermittent failures in its integration test suite over the past three sprints, primarily in the settlement-retry scenarios. Failure rates exceed our 2% flakiness threshold, which blocks confident releases. We have begun quarantining the worst offenders and tracking root causes. The full flake dashboard and triage notes are here.

operations page: https://jenkins.zemvarcloud.local/job/merge_requests/repo/build/73930b4b30f0a8ed